Kotu and Deshpande's "Predictive Analytics and Data Mining" serves as an accessible introduction to the foundational concepts and practical applications of data science. The book systematically unpacks key methodologies, including regression, classification, clustering, and association rules, guiding readers through the entire analytical process from problem definition to model deployment. It emphasizes the business context and strategic value of analytics, bridging the gap between theoretical knowledge and real-world implementation. Designed for business professionals and aspiring data scientists, it provides a clear, concise overview without requiring deep prior mathematical expertise, focusing instead on intuitive understanding and practical utility.

Key themes
- Data-Driven Decision Making
- This theme is central to the entire book, advocating for the transformation of raw data into actionable insights to guide strategic and operational decisions. The authors consistently highlight how predictive analytics enables businesses to move beyond intuition, using evidence to forecast trends, optimize processes, and gain competitive advantages. It's presented as a fundamental shift in organizational culture towards relying on empirical evidence.
- The Analytical Process Lifecycle
- The book meticulously outlines the systematic, iterative stages involved in a data mining project, from problem definition and data collection to model building, evaluation, and deployment. This theme underscores that successful analytics is not a one-off task but a structured, cyclical process requiring careful planning, execution, and refinement at each stage. It emphasizes the importance of a structured approach to ensure reliable and impactful results.
- Ethical Considerations and Responsible AI
- While not the primary focus, the book dedicates attention to the ethical implications of predictive analytics, particularly concerning data privacy, fairness, and the potential for bias in models. This theme encourages a thoughtful and responsible approach to data science, prompting readers to consider the societal impact of their analytical work and the importance of transparency and accountability in model development and deployment.
